Brandon Johnson

Senior Software Engineer at Moov Financial

Brandon Johnson is a Senior Software Engineer at Moov Financial. Brandon previously worked at Lucerna Health from June 2020 to October 2020 as a Senior Software and Data Engineer.

At Lucerna, Brandon led a team of engineers in building a deeply-integrated process monitoring flow in Python and AWS, to track metrics, logs, and states. This required Django API endpoints, Spark/Glue integration, Lambda functions, an SQS queue, SNS topics, S3 event triggers, CloudWatch metrics, and React UI pages.

Brandon also led a team of engineers on a data orchestration flow, which featured the ability to configure data extraction from a list of database types, given database connection details and a customer-provided SQL query. The extracted data would then be dropped into a data processing pipeline, which ran through several transformation steps including mapping, cleaning, wrangling, enrichment, and analysis.

Some of Brandon's other accomplishments at Lucerna include developing batch processing ETL data pipelines with Python and Spark, and deploying them to AWS. The AWS Glue jobs utilized S3 as a data warehouse and went through several steps in an AWS Step Functions state machine, moving data between S3, Athena, and Redshift.

Brandon Johnson's educational career includes a Bachelor of Science in Accounting from the University of Utah and a Management Information Systems degree from the same school. Brandon also has certifications from HackerRank in Ruby (intermediate) skill assessment, from the University of Utah in Bachelor of Science Degree, and from Amazon Web Services (AWS) in AWS Certified Developer - Associate (DVA).

Brandon Johnson works with Eric Allen - Manager, Software Engineering, John Weispfenning - Software Engineer, and Logan Hendricks - Software Engineer. Brandon Johnson reports to Aaron Bell, Director of Engineering.

Links

Timeline

  • Senior Software Engineer

    Current role

View in org chart